Opener Repair
Opener repair in Teaneck typically costs $120-$320. The most common call we get is an opener that hums but won’t lift, or one that reverses immediately after starting. In Teaneck’s low-lying eastern blocks near the Hackensack River, we often find rusted bottom brackets and rollers caused by ground moisture. The opener isn’t broken; it’s protecting itself from a door that won’t move freely. We clean, lubricate, and replace the hardware so the motor isn’t fighting corrosion. Freeze-thaw cycles also crack concrete aprons across Bergen County, which shifts tracks and causes opener limit switches to drift out of calibration. We realign and reset limits as part of the repair.

Common Garage Door Opener Problems We See in Teaneck Homes
- Tripped breakers on retrofitted circuits. In the 1980s, many detached Teaneck garages got openers added to branch circuits already carrying heavy loads. The breaker trips before the opener motor ever strains. We check the electrical first. Often the fix is a dedicated circuit, not a new opener.
- Opener limits drifting after freeze-thaw cycles. Bergen County winters heave concrete aprons and shift tracks. The door doesn’t reach the floor consistently, so the opener’s travel limits need seasonal adjustment. We see this on Cedar Lane-area homes and throughout the western hills.
- Rust-corroded bottom hardware jamming openers. Ground moisture in Teaneck’s eastern floodplain blocks attacks rollers, hinges, and bottom brackets. The opener motor detects resistance and reverses, or the chain skips. The motor isn’t failing; the hardware is seized.
- Outdated wiring blocking smart upgrades. A 1960s two-car garage in Teaneck may have a single 15-amp circuit serving lights, outlets, and now a Wi-Fi-enabled opener with camera. The draw overloads the system. We upgrade the electrical before installing the smart unit, so you don’t get a “connected” opener that disconnects every time the lights are on.

Yes. A wind-rated or impact-rated door is heavier and requires a higher-horsepower opener, typically 3/4 HP rather than 1/2 HP, plus a reinforced rail system. In Teaneck, where nor’easters and coastal wind events stress garage doors, we match the opener to the door’s weight and wind-load certification. Installing an underpowered opener on a heavy wind-rated door burns out the motor prematurely. We size it right the first time.
Repeated freezing and thawing cracks concrete aprons and shifts door tracks, which changes where the door sits in its travel path. The opener’s limit switches, set for a specific closed position, no longer match reality. The door may reverse unexpectedly or leave a gap at the floor. We see this every spring in Teaneck. The fix is track realignment and limit recalibration, not a new opener. Call (877) 379-8821 if your door started acting up after the last hard freeze.
